Transaction 34cbea12265d305bbc5be69033d143c7ae6e069e045f9e8b63b57d54fa56d294

1 Input
2 Outputs
  • 34cbea12265d305bbc5be69033d143c7ae6e069e045f9e8b63b57d54fa56d294:0
  • value  429687
    address  2NBMEXkmBScVHEJ3v8TogRaNVp5A38k8U4P
  • 34cbea12265d305bbc5be69033d143c7ae6e069e045f9e8b63b57d54fa56d294:1
  • value  809761747
    address  2N8g7YFAwZnWHRDhf55d2cahjRMLsdKUVBT